Quick context for the sync: Squallwire fans out weather alerts from the ingest queue to regional push workers. Each worker claims a shard, renders templates, and hands batches to the delivery edge. Backpressure is handled by pausing shard claims, not dropping alerts — check the lag dashboard before blaming delivery. New hires: run the fan-out locally with the stub edge first. The real delivery edge authenticates every batch with a shared token, which your local env file must define on the very next line.

env line for fafof-fahag: LEDGER_TOKEN5=f8790

**Vendor note: Inkmill markdown pipeline**

Rendering for Parchway docs is outsourced to Inkmill under an annual contract, renewing each March. They handle sanitization and PDF export; we own the upload queue. SLA: 4-hour response on rendering failures. Escalate only after two failed retries. Their support desk is reachable at the address below.

billing contact of hahaf-baguf = zorael.tammir.jorius@sivrelhq.internal

**Ticket VLT-Audio: Waveform preview vault locked**

The Brindlecast audio pipeline generates waveform previews for uploaded tracks, and the rendering keys live in the Coppermire vault. After last night's node rotation the vault sealed itself, so previews are failing with a blank strip instead of the usual waveform. New team members: this is routine. Unseal using the standard procedure in the ops wiki, then restart the preview workers. The recovery passphrase needed for unsealing is provided below.

strongbox words: jorir-eliiel-gilys-zorys-eliir-aldion-aldvan-pelmir-silax-rusdor-istix-noviel-frair-tamion

Legacy rates sit 30% below current list; uplift of 12% proposed, phased over two billing cycles. Roughly 400 accounts affected, concentrated in the Everling region. Churn modelling predicts 5% attrition, offset within three quarters. Retention offers limited to top-tier accounts only; no ad hoc exceptions. Communications launch after leadership sign-off. Scripts and objection handling to follow from enablement. The strategic rationale is set out in the confidential note below.

board note of fahog-bawep: The renewal with Holixax Holdings closes at $20 million a year, 20 percent below the last contract. Project Druwyn slips by two quarters because of the supplier delay.